Question 670583: I do not understand how to work through this problem or even where to start.
Any help in greatly appreciated. Thank you in advance.
Simplify and Combine like terms: (8x-5)(x^2+6x)-(9x+2)(4x^2-3)
Answer: -28x^3+62x^2-24x
Hi,
(8x-5) (x^2+6x) -(9x+2)(4x^2-3)=
8x(x^2+6x)-5(x^2+6x)-9x(4x^2-3)-2(4x^2-3)]
8x^3 + 48x^2 -5x^2 - 30x.....etc ||finish Up, combine Like terms
You can see the 8x^3 - 36x^3 = -28x^3
